Perched on the Sorrentine Peninsula with sweeping views of the Tyrrhenian Sea and Capri beyond, Villa Giovanna commands a dramatic clifftop position overlooking the Amalfi Coast.
The hotel's terraced gardens cascade down sun-drenched hillsides, with Mediterranean vegetation framing ceremony backdrops of blue water and distant mountain silhouettes.
Stone archways, lemon trees, and whitewashed architecture create an authentic Campanian landscape that has hosted celebrations for 20+ years.

Clifftop location 150 meters above sea level with unobstructed views of the Bay of Naples and Capri island
5 distinct event spaces ranging from intimate garden terraces to a covered loggia accommodating 20-150 guests
Direct access to private beach club via elevator through limestone cliffs
On-site accommodations with 60+ rooms allowing multi-night guest stays

Asked along the way.
What is included in venue rental?+
Package typically includes ceremony and reception spaces, tables, chairs, basic linens, and access to hotel grounds. Bar service, catering, and decorations are quoted separately based on guest count and menu selections.
Can we use an outside caterer?+
Villa Giovanna requires food and beverage to be provided by their in-house culinary team. Dietary restrictions and custom menu development are accommodated upon request.
What is the best season for a wedding here?+
April-May and September-October offer ideal conditions with warm weather, calm seas, and manageable summer crowds. June-August can be extremely hot; November-March sees occasional rain but fewer tourists.
Is there guest accommodation?+
Yes. The villa operates as a 4-star hotel with 60 rooms available for wedding guests at negotiated rates, typically 15-25% discount for wedding parties of 50+ guests.
What weather contingencies exist?+
Indoor reception hall with climate control accommodates up to 120 guests. Retractable awnings cover outdoor terraces. Coastal storms are rare but can occur in winter months.
